- industry-category-item-resource
- industry-resource
- company-resource
- company-industry-resource
- company-category-resource
- category-item-resource
- category-resource
- user-resource
- account-resource
- authenticate-controller
- public-user-resource
- survey-attribute-resource
- survey-resource
- survey-main-resource
- survey-data-resource
- rule-resource
- rule-survey-resource
- quota-item-resource
- quota-resource
- data-result-resource
- data-config-resource
- import-detail-contrller
- user-jwt-controller
- export-detail-contrller
- report-resource
- test-data-api
/api/admin/users
PUT
/api/admin/users
user-resource
请求参数
Header 参数
Authorization
string
可选
默认值:
Bearer eyJhbGciOiJIUzUxMiJ9.eyJzdWIiOiJhZG1pbiIsImF1dGgiOiJST0xFX0FETUlOLFJPTEVfVVNFUiIsImV4cCI6MTY5NDg1NjAyN30.ucimYoIO3BLwsXzgFdT9D2F08goUkTojjvK8NZ41Tu7hMHw7eNaX_jv2pWQY0pQcgGhRSpsxceGthP-n4R5w1w
Body 参数application/json
id
string <uuid>
可选
login
string
必需
>= 1 字符<= 50 字符
正则匹配:
^(?>[a-zA-Z0-9!$&*+=?^_`{|}~.-]+@[a-zA-Z0-9-]+(?:\.[a-zA-Z0-9-]+)*)|(?>[_.@A-Za-z0-9-]+)$
firstName
string
可选
>= 0 字符<= 50 字符
lastName
string
可选
>= 0 字符<= 50 字符
email
string
可选
>= 5 字符<= 254 字符
imageUrl
string
可选
>= 0 字符<= 256 字符
activated
boolean
可选
langKey
string
可选
>= 2 字符<= 10 字符
createdBy
string
可选
createdDate
string <date-time>
可选
lastModifiedBy
string
可选
lastModifiedDate
string <date-time>
可选
authorities
array[string]
可选
示例
{
"id": "497f6eca-6276-4993-bfeb-53cbbbba6f08",
"login": "string",
"firstName": "string",
"lastName": "string",
"email": "string",
"imageUrl": "string",
"activated": true,
"langKey": "string",
"createdBy": "string",
"createdDate": "2019-08-24T14:15:22Z",
"lastModifiedBy": "string",
"lastModifiedDate": "2019-08-24T14:15:22Z",
"authorities": [
"string"
]
}
示例代码
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request PUT 'http://localhost:8851/api/admin/users' \
--header 'Authorization: Bearer eyJhbGciOiJIUzUxMiJ9.eyJzdWIiOiJhZG1pbiIsImF1dGgiOiJST0xFX0FETUlOLFJPTEVfVVNFUiIsImV4cCI6MTY5NDg1NjAyN30.ucimYoIO3BLwsXzgFdT9D2F08goUkTojjvK8NZ41Tu7hMHw7eNaX_jv2pWQY0pQcgGhRSpsxceGthP-n4R5w1w' \
--header 'Content-Type: application/json' \
--data-raw '{
"id": "497f6eca-6276-4993-bfeb-53cbbbba6f08",
"login": "string",
"firstName": "string",
"lastName": "string",
"email": "string",
"imageUrl": "string",
"activated": true,
"langKey": "string",
"createdBy": "string",
"createdDate": "2019-08-24T14:15:22Z",
"lastModifiedBy": "string",
"lastModifiedDate": "2019-08-24T14:15:22Z",
"authorities": [
"string"
]
}'
返回响应
🟢200OK
application/json
Body
id
string <uuid>
可选
login
string
必需
>= 1 字符<= 50 字符
正则匹配:
^(?>[a-zA-Z0-9!$&*+=?^_`{|}~.-]+@[a-zA-Z0-9-]+(?:\.[a-zA-Z0-9-]+)*)|(?>[_.@A-Za-z0-9-]+)$
firstName
string
可选
>= 0 字符<= 50 字符
lastName
string
可选
>= 0 字符<= 50 字符
email
string
可选
>= 5 字符<= 254 字符
imageUrl
string
可选
>= 0 字符<= 256 字符
activated
boolean
可选
langKey
string
可选
>= 2 字符<= 10 字符
createdBy
string
可选
createdDate
string <date-time>
可选
lastModifiedBy
string
可选
lastModifiedDate
string <date-time>
可选
authorities
array[string]
可选
示例
{
"id": "497f6eca-6276-4993-bfeb-53cbbbba6f08",
"login": "string",
"firstName": "string",
"lastName": "string",
"email": "string",
"imageUrl": "string",
"activated": true,
"langKey": "string",
"createdBy": "string",
"createdDate": "2019-08-24T14:15:22Z",
"lastModifiedBy": "string",
"lastModifiedDate": "2019-08-24T14:15:22Z",
"authorities": [
"string"
]
}